Warren Rural Electric Cooperative Corporation

Information Technology Department

Manager of Information Technology

Objectives
  • To oversee the efficient and secure operation of the IT infrastructure and systems, ensuring a productive, dependable, secure, and scalable work environment.
  • To manage the Cooperative's Cybersecurity Program.
  • To oversee technical support and training initiatives for employees.
  • To evaluate, design, implement and support IT systems to enhance the Cooperative's goals and objectives of Warren RECC.
Reporting Relationships
  • Reports to: Vice President of Member Services and IT
  • Directs: Information Technology Technician(s), Senior Information Technology Technician(s), Information Technology Administrator(s), Communications Systems Supervisor
Essential Functions
  • Formulate the annual IT work plan and budget in coordination with the Management Team. Work closely with vice presidents and department managers to identify hardware or software needs. Ensure adequate resources are available to meet those needs.
  • Oversee implementation of the annual IT work plan and budgeted projects.
  • Stay abreast of new technology developments that will benefit and enhance employee productivity, IT operational stability and efficiency, and security.
  • Act as the Cooperative's Cybersecurity Officer. Work with IT staff in the implementation of the Cybersecurity Program, including the incident response and disaster recovery plan.
  • Ensure the Cooperative is compliant with the Payment Card Industry (PCI) Security Standards as outlined by the PCI Security Standards Council.
  • Oversee the Cooperative's IT policies and procedures for conformance with changing IT needs involving efficiency, security, back-ups, incident response, disaster recovery, and other IT-related environments.
  • Coordinate with Cooperative's Managers work involving information systems and technologies that impact corporate processes, providing support and direction and ensuring system are functionally integrated as needed.
  • Direct implementation plans involving the Cooperative's communication systems, including the fiber backbone, SCADA, Internet, voice and data.
  • Identify and provide adequate computing resources for all information systems, including network and bandwidth requirements.
  • Identify and analyze operational problems, working with IT staff to evaluate alternatives and implement effective solutions.
  • Evaluate bids and specifications in the selection of computer and networking hardware, software, communication equipment and other IT-related equipment.
  • Oversee maintenance of all IT-related systems and data files.
  • Coordinate installation and maintenance of computer applications and systems for all departments.
  • Assist training employees to meet specific job requirements.

Job Specifications

POSITION: Manager of Information Technology

Education
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or Communication Systems related field required. Other fields of study and/or equivalent combination of education/training and relevant experience will be considered.
  • Additional training in business administration and accounting is preferred.
Experience
  • Minimum ten years of work experience in information systems, communication systems or related technologies.
  • Five years of experience in a supervisory or leadership role required.
Knowledge
  • Client/server technology and network architecture
  • Network operating systems UNIX, Linux, Microsoft Windows Server and network protocols, mainly Ethernet and TCP/IP
  • Network applications (e.g. e-mail system, network security applications, system backups, IP Telephony)
  • LAN/WAN routing and switching
  • Network security, firewalls, anti-malware systems
  • SCADA systems
  • Communication systems, including fiber optic and IP telephony systems
  • Microsoft Office, including Word, Excel, Outlook, and Teams.
Abilities and Skills
  • Strong problem-solving, critical thinking and decision-making skills.
  • Ability to analyze and implement new technologies and applications.
  • Ability to effectively and courteously communicate in person and by telephone
  • Ability to effectively and professionally communicate in writing
  • Ability to maintain professionalism and effectively perform in stressful situations
  • Ability to effectively and professionally manage and prioritize multiple projects
  • Ability to exercise independent judgement within parameters of the Cooperative's policies and procedures
  • Ability to maintain strict confidentiality of highly sensitive information, both internally and externally
Working Conditions

Normal office conditions, with prolonged periods sitting at a desk working on a computer, with some travel to district office locations. Some fieldwork may be required. Must be able to work overtime as needed, including nights, weekends, and holidays. Work hours are generally aligned with standard office hours, which may vary to meet the needs and demands of the Cooperative, requiring some after-hours and weekend work. Overnight travel may be required to attend out-of-town training and meetings.

Other
  • Must have a valid driver's license.
